Understanding the Role of a Real Estate Agent

Before you start your search, it’s essential to understand the role of a real estate agent and what they can do for you. A real estate agent is a licensed professional who acts as an intermediary between buyers and sellers in the real estate market. Their primary function is to facilitate the buying and selling of properties by providing expertise, guidance, and support throughout the entire process. A good agent will have in-depth knowledge of the local market, including current trends, prices, and regulations. They will also have access to a wide range of properties, including those that are not publicly listed, and can provide valuable insights and advice to help you make informed decisions.

Key Responsibilities of a Real Estate Agent

Some of the key responsibilities of a real estate agent include:

  • Providing market analysis and pricing guidance
  • Listing and marketing properties for sale
  • Showing properties to potential buyers
  • Negotiating offers and terms of sale
  • Coordinating inspections, appraisals, and other due diligence activities
  • Facilitating communication between parties and ensuring a smooth transaction process

How to Find a Real Estate Agent in Toronto

Finding a real estate agent in Toronto involves research, networking, and careful evaluation. Here are some steps you can follow to find the right agent for you:

Ask for Referrals

One of the best ways to find a good real estate agent is to ask for referrals from friends, family, or colleagues who have recently bought or sold a property in Toronto. They can provide firsthand information about their experiences, both positive and negative, and recommend agents who have delivered excellent service.

Check Online Reviews and Ratings

Another way to find a real estate agent is to check online reviews and ratings on websites such as Google, Yelp, or Realtor.ca. These platforms allow you to read reviews from past clients and get an idea of an agent’s reputation, expertise, and level of service. Look for agents with high ratings and positive reviews, as they are likely to provide better service.

Check with Professional Associations

You can also check with professional associations such as the Toronto Regional Real Estate Board (TRREB) or the Ontario Real Estate Association (OREA) for a list of licensed and qualified real estate agents in Toronto. These organizations have strict membership requirements and can provide assurance that the agents listed are competent and trustworthy.

How do I evaluate the reputation of a real estate agent in Toronto?

Evaluating the reputation of a real estate agent in Toronto involves researching their past performance, client reviews, and professional credentials. You can start by checking online reviews on websites such as Google, Yelp, or Facebook, to see what past clients have to say about their experience with the agent. You can also ask for referrals from friends, family, or colleagues who have worked with the agent, and ask about their level of satisfaction with the service they received. Additionally, you can check the agent’s credentials, such as their license and membership in professional organizations, to ensure they are qualified and reputable.

A reputable real estate agent in Toronto should also be transparent about their sales history, including the number of properties they’ve sold, the average sale price, and the days on market. They should also be willing to provide references from past clients, and have a strong online presence, including a professional website and social media profiles. By evaluating an agent’s reputation, you can get a sense of their level of expertise, professionalism, and commitment to customer service, and make an informed decision about whether to work with them. It’s also a good idea to check if the agent has any disciplinary actions or complaints filed against them with the relevant regulatory bodies.
